well i think i have stopped the log getting out of hand

 

i have done two things

 

1) turned off DLNA Play to

2) created a profile for the TV using the Sony Bravia 2014 profile as a model - just updated the TV name in a few places and called the profile the name of the tv

 

so far (after an emby reboot) i only have a log file of 79KB

 

fingers crossed that one or both have solved the problem
